Powered with Merc. 5.0 EFI and Alpha drive, 2008 Venture trailer, bow & cockpit covers, bimini top with full enclosure. Ski/tow eye, stainless prop, 3 step swim ladder, carpet, compass and VHF. In dash depth finder, stereo with cassette, Eagle Cuda 128 and walk thru windshield. Back to back fold down/open helm& passenger seats, removable rear jump seats, in floor ski locker, bow anchor storage and side storage compartment.
